Rationalization is an emotional plea to maintain the integrity of one’s personal reality. It’s a denial, a desperate move to maintain the illusion of control over reality. It’s like a captain aboard a sinking ship saying, β€œWe aren’t sinking! All this water in the ship is because of last night’s storm.” A Learner understands they control only their choices, and attempting to equalize what’s really happening to what we want to happen is a fool’s errand. A person with this ability doesn’t make excuses or twist the narrative to fit what they imagine or want to be real.
